Inflation Austria 1996
Average inflation: 1.9%
Current Inflation
Inflation is low at 1.9%, below the ECB target of 2%.
Peak and Trough
The highest inflation was in November at 2.3%. The lowest inflation was in May at 1.5%.

Month overview
| Month | Inflation | Difference vs. 1995 |
|---|---|---|
| January | 1.6% | -1.0 |
| February | 1.6% | -0.8 |
| March | 1.8% | -0.6 |
| April | 1.6% | -1.0 |
| May | 1.5% | -0.9 |
| June | 1.7% | -0.9 |
| July | 1.9% | -0.3 |
| August | 1.9% | -0.2 |
| September | 2.0% | 0.0 |
| October | 2.1% | +0.2 |
| November | 2.3% | +0.4 |
| December | 2.3% | +0.5 |
| Average | 1.9% |
